Key Skills Gained Through a BBA Program

A BBA degree provides students with a broad understanding of various aspects of business management, from marketing and finance to human resources and operations. Let’s take a closer look at how the skills learned during a BBA program can help in entrepreneurship:

1. Business Planning and Strategy

One of the core elements of a BBA program is learning how to develop business strategies. Whether it’s a startup or an established business, having a clear plan and strategy is crucial for success. A BBA student learns how to draft business plans, conduct market research, analyze competitors, and identify potential risks. These are key elements when launching a business and ensuring its long-term sustainability.

2. Leadership and Team Management

Entrepreneurs often need to wear many hats, and managing a team is one of the most important roles. During a BBA degree, students are trained in leadership and people management, learning how to inspire, motivate, and lead a team. From managing employees to coordinating with external partners, these skills are essential for any entrepreneur to succeed.

3. Marketing and Sales Skills

Marketing is the backbone of any business. A BBA program includes comprehensive coursework on marketing, teaching students about market analysis, consumer behavior, branding, and digital marketing. These skills help budding entrepreneurs identify their target audience, create effective marketing campaigns, and promote their products or services in the market.

For instance, a BBA graduate who starts a business in the fashion industry will know how to create a marketing plan, use social media for promotions, and attract customers through effective advertising techniques.

4. Financial Management

Every entrepreneur needs to have a solid understanding of financial management. In a BBA program, students learn how to manage finances, prepare budgets, understand profit and loss statements, and evaluate investment opportunities. This knowledge helps entrepreneurs in managing cash flow, securing funding, and making sound financial decisions that can drive their business growth.

5. Problem-Solving and Critical Thinking

Business is full of uncertainties and challenges. A BBA program equips students with problem-solving and critical-thinking skills that allow them to deal with the ups and downs of running a business. Whether it’s resolving conflicts within the team, overcoming market competition, or dealing with an economic downturn, these skills can be the key to survival for any startup.

Steps to Becoming an Entrepreneur with a BBA Degree

If you’re a BBA student or graduate interested in starting your own business, here are some practical steps to get you started:

1. Identify a Business Idea

Think of a unique idea or identify a gap in the market where you can offer a product or service. Make sure your idea solves a problem or addresses a specific need.

2. Create a Business Plan

A well-structured business plan is essential for securing funding and planning your business operations. Outline your goals, strategies, target market, and financial projections.

3. Start Small and Scale Gradually

It’s always a good idea to start small and test your business idea in the market before scaling up. This minimizes risks and allows you to make adjustments based on feedback and performance.

4. Leverage Your BBA Network

Make the most of the connections you’ve built during your BBA program. Whether it’s your professors, classmates, or alumni, having a strong network can help you find mentors, investors, and business partners.

5. Seek Funding

There are several funding options available for startups, including venture capital, angel investors, and government grants. Prepare a solid pitch to present your business idea to potential investors.
